Bioessence PH, one of the country's premier beauty brands, celebrated its 30th anniversary last night with an elegant Pearl Anniversary event.

 


Held on September 26 at The Blue Leaf Cosmopolitan, the night gathered nearly a thousand guests, including VIPs, loyal clients, media, influencers, and special performers, to enjoy an evening dedicated to beauty and wellness.

New Product and Machine Previews

During the event, Bioessence unveiled new OxygenCeuticals (OC) products, exclusive to their clinics. Originating from South Korea, OxygenCeuticals has been a trusted partner of Bioessence since 2015. These new skincare products were presented in an interactive booth, allowing guests to explore and personally test the entire OC line.

 


In addition, the brand showcased its newest machine, Harmony, complementing their advanced non-invasive treatments, Exilis and Plasma. Guests watched live demonstrations of these state-of-the-art devices in action at a specially created clinic under the guidance of Bioessence’s expert trainers and consultants.

 


Website and App Revamp

Bioessence also introduced their newly revamped website, designed to provide a seamless experience for clients. Integrated with ESSIE, their new app, the platform offers real-time syncing for service bookings and schedules, accessible anytime. This marks another step in their mission of #CaringBeyondBeauty, ensuring that clients’ experience is elevated even before stepping into a clinic.

Adding to the digital transformation, Bioessence launched a skin assessment tool, Perfect Skin, which allows users to quickly diagnose skin concerns and receive personalized treatment recommendations—all through a simple photo.
